Output 39d7a649cebf92ce7eaef5d039f9cdc95c8a5fa9d9396f08f5ef7621064bf3e9:1

value
2665175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cc76d0f132604e1c19a7cdcae60ec06875df9ed OP_EQUALVERIFY OP_CHECKSIG
address
17zyFwbWf81KAgEWHpifE8PCbVkADvq8b6
transaction
39d7a649cebf92ce7eaef5d039f9cdc95c8a5fa9d9396f08f5ef7621064bf3e9
confirmations
453332
spent
true